Who: Targeted to executives and senior managers in Supply Chain, Retail and Government Services who have an interest in learning more about why and how to protect valuable data in their back-end systems from the very real and growing threat of cyber crime. | Capacity: 120 participants
Why: This half-day symposium will provide an objective executive briefing on cyber security topics and how it’s dramatically affecting the current business climate in Canada, including:
- Advanced Persistent Threat
- Cyber Crime
- Cyber Terrorism
- Hacktivism
This highly-engaging and interactive symposium aims to help participants understand the various roles, risks and actors on this stage; the impact of cloud computing; and, especially, how to prevent, manage and contain the risks. This symposium will build on the outcomes of a high-demand session Sheridan presented about cyber crime at the recent International Supply Chain Symposium in Toronto.
